To send bulk mail in Outlook, follow these steps:

  1. Open Outlook and go to the "Home" tab.
  2. Click on the "New Email" button to create a new email message.
  3. In the "To" field, click on the "Contacts" button and select the contact group or distribution list you want to send the email to.
  4. Compose your email message as usual.
  5. Click on the "Send" button to send the email to all recipients on your list.
